Surrounded by the stunning countryside of South West Scotland, A’ the Airts Community Art Centre warmly welcome you to the Royal Burgh of Sanquhar, the home of the original Sanquhar patterns. Learn about the history and heritage of this traditional way of knitting, still practiced today.
A community project known as Sanquhar Pattern Designs will share with you captivating presentations and hands-on demonstrations.
